I taped off the top half of mine and put some stick on stars on it and then painted it blue. When the paint dried and I took the tape and stars off, I had a blue field with white stars. Next, I taped off the top and taped off stripes on the bottom half; painting this red.
When that dried I peeled off the tape and shot it with clear acrylic.
Now I have the stars and stripes on the center console of my bicenteniel vette. :cheers:
Cheap and effective
